Uses of Class
name.matthewgreet.strutscommons.validators.ConversionResult
Packages that use ConversionResult
Package
Description
-
Uses of ConversionResult in name.matthewgreet.strutscommons.interceptor
Methods in name.matthewgreet.strutscommons.interceptor that return ConversionResultModifier and TypeMethodDescriptionAnnotationValidationInterceptor.ConversionFieldResult.getConversionResult()
protected <T> ConversionResult
<T> AnnotationValidationInterceptor.validateCollectionConversion
(Field unconvertedField, Annotation annotation, CollectionConverter<?, T> collectionConversionValidator, String formValue, Field recipientField, Class<T> recipientClass) Calls validator to convert string form field value to recipient field of expected data type.protected <T> ConversionResult
<T> AnnotationValidationInterceptor.validateConversion
(Field unconvertedField, Annotation annotation, Converter<?, T> conversionValidator, String formValue, Field recipientField, Class<T> recipientClass) Calls validator to convert string form field value to recipient field of expected data type.Constructors in name.matthewgreet.strutscommons.interceptor with parameters of type ConversionResultModifierConstructorDescriptionConversionFieldResult
(Field recipeintField, ConversionResult<T> conversionResult) -
Uses of ConversionResult in name.matthewgreet.strutscommons.validators
Methods in name.matthewgreet.strutscommons.validators that return ConversionResultModifier and TypeMethodDescriptionBigDecimalConverter.convert
(String formValue, Class<BigDecimal> recipientClass) CollectionConverter.convert
(String formValue, Class<?> recipientFieldClass, Class<T> recipientClass) Returns result of conversion of form field.Returns result of conversion of form field.IntegerCSVConverter.convert
(String formValue, Class<?> recipientFieldClass, Class<Integer> recipientClass) StringCSVConverter.convert
(String formValue, Class<?> recipientFieldClass, Class<String> recipientClass) static <T> ConversionResult
<T> ConversionResult.makeFailureResult()
Returns result for failed conversion and using annotation message configuration.static <T> ConversionResult
<T> ConversionResult.makeFailureWithMessageKeyResult
(String messageKey, Required.MessageType messageType) Returns result for failed conversion and using supplied message key.static <T> ConversionResult
<T> ConversionResult.makeFailureWithMessageResult
(String message, Required.MessageType messageType) Returns result for failed conversion and using supplied message.static <T> ConversionResult
<T> ConversionResult.makeSkippedCollectionResult
(Collection<T> emptyCollection) Returns result for when field value is an empty string, skipping collection-based conversion.static <T> ConversionResult
<T> ConversionResult.makeSkippedResult()
Returns result for when field value is an empty string, skipping single value conversion.static <T> ConversionResult
<T> ConversionResult.makeSuccessCollectionResult
(Collection<T> parsedValue) Returns result for successful collection-based conversion.static <T> ConversionResult
<T> ConversionResult.makeSuccessResult
(T parsedValue) Returns result for successful single value conversion.